home *** CD-ROM | disk | FTP | other *** search
/ What the Doctor Required - The Freshest December / December.iso / windows / mem1614 / driver20.cab / qcs10002.spd < prev    next >
Encoding:
PostScript Printer Description  |  1997-10-20  |  9.7 KB  |  274 lines

  1. *PPD-Adobe: "4.0"
  2. *% QCS10002.spd: Simplified form of QCS10002.ppd
  3. *PCFileName: "QCS10002.PPD"
  4. *Product: "(QMS ColorScript Laser 1000)"
  5. *PSVersion: "(2011.23) 2"
  6. *ModelName: "ColorScript 1000 Level 2"
  7. *NickName: "ColorScript 1000 Level 2"
  8. *ShortNickName: "QMS ColorScript 1000 Level 2"
  9. *LanguageLevel: "2"
  10. *AcceptsTrueType: True
  11. *FreeVM: "439330"
  12. *ColorDevice: True
  13. *Password: "0"
  14. *ExitServer: "
  15.  count 0 eq
  16.  { false } { true exch startjob } ifelse
  17.  not { 
  18.      (WARNING : Cannot perform the exitserver command.) = 
  19.      (Password supplied is not valid.) = 
  20.      (Please contact the author of this software.) = flush quit
  21.      } if
  22. "
  23. *End
  24. *OpenUI *ColorRenderDict/Color Rendering Dictionaries: PickOne
  25. *OrderDependency: 50 AnySetup *ColorRenderDict
  26. *DefaultColorRenderDict: 1
  27. *ColorRenderDict 1/Default: "% Use default CRD"    
  28. *ColorRenderDict 2/Photographic: "/Photographic /ColorRendering findresource setcolorrendering"    
  29. *ColorRenderDict 3/Colorimetric: "/Colorimetric /ColorRendering findresource setcolorrendering"    
  30. *ColorRenderDict 4/Business: "/Business /ColorRendering findresource setcolorrendering"    
  31. *CloseUI: *ColorRenderDict
  32. *OpenUI *HalftoneType/Halftones: PickOne
  33. *OrderDependency: 50 AnySetup *HalftoneType
  34. *DefaultHalftoneType: 4
  35. *HalftoneType 1/Default:"% Use default halftone"
  36. *HalftoneType 2/Presentation:"/Presentation /Halftone findresource sethalftone"
  37. *HalftoneType 3/PresentationLow/Presentation - 45 LPI:"/PresentationLow /Halftone findresource sethalftone"
  38. *HalftoneType 4/Proofing - 4 color:"/Proofing4Color /Halftone findresource sethalftone"
  39. *HalftoneType 5/Traditional 53LPI x (C15,M75,Y45,K45):"/Traditional /Halftone findresource sethalftone"
  40. *HalftoneType 6/Aligned 53LPI x 45:"/53x45 /Halftone findresource sethalftone"
  41. *HalftoneType 7/Aligned 45LPI x 45:"/45x45 /Halftone findresource sethalftone"
  42. *HalftoneType 8/Aligned 60LPI x 54:"/60x54 /Halftone findresource sethalftone"
  43. *HalftoneType 9/Presentation60/Presentation 60:"/Presentation60 /Halftone findresource sethalftone"
  44. *HalftoneType 10/PresentationHigh/Presentation HI:"/PresentationHigh /Halftone findresource sethalftone"
  45. *CloseUI: *HalftoneType
  46. *OpenUI *Colormodel/Colormodels: PickOne
  47. *OrderDependency: 50 AnySetup *Colormodel
  48. *DefaultColormodel: 2
  49. *Colormodel 1/Gray:"%%IncludeFeature: colormodel(graymodel)"
  50. *Colormodel 2/CMYK:"%%IncludeFeature: colormodel(cmyk)"
  51. *CloseUI: *Colormodel
  52. *OpenUI *Separations: Boolean
  53. *OrderDependency: 40 AnySetup *Separations
  54. *Separations True: "%%IncludeFeature: colorseparation(on)"
  55. *Separations False: "%%IncludeFeature: colorseparation(off)"
  56. *DefaultSeparations: False
  57. *?Separations: "
  58.    save currentpagedevice /Separations get
  59.   {(True)}{(False)}ifelse = flush restore" 
  60. *End
  61. *CloseUI: *Separations
  62. *DefaultResolution: 300dpi
  63. *?Resolution: "
  64.   save
  65.     currentpagedevice /HWResolution get
  66.     0 get
  67.     (          ) cvs print
  68.     (dpi)
  69.     = flush
  70.   restore
  71. "
  72. *End
  73. *ScreenFreq: "53.0"
  74. *ScreenAngle: "45.0"
  75. *OpenUI *PageSize: PickOne
  76. *OrderDependency: 30 AnySetup *PageSize
  77. *DefaultPageSize: Letter
  78. *PageSize Letter: "
  79.     2 dict dup /PageSize [612 792] put dup /ImagingBBox null put setpagedevice"
  80. *End
  81. *PageSize Legal: "
  82.     2 dict dup /PageSize [612 1008] put dup /ImagingBBox null put setpagedevice"
  83. *End
  84. *PageSize A4: "
  85.     2 dict dup /PageSize [595 842] put dup /ImagingBBox null put setpagedevice"
  86. *End
  87. *PageSize Executive: "
  88.     2 dict dup /PageSize [522 757] put dup /ImagingBBox null put setpagedevice"
  89. *End
  90. *?PageSize: "
  91.  save
  92.    currentpagedevice /PageSize get aload pop
  93.    2 copy gt {exch} if 
  94.    (Unknown) 
  95.    6 dict
  96.    dup [612 792] (Letter) put
  97.    dup [612 1008] (Legal) put
  98.    dup [595 842] (A4) put
  99.    dup [522 757] (Executive) put
  100.  { exch aload  pop 4 index sub abs 5 le exch 
  101.    5 index sub abs 5 le and 
  102.       {exch pop exit} {pop} ifelse
  103.    } bind forall
  104.    = flush pop pop
  105. restore 
  106. "
  107. *End
  108. *CloseUI: *PageSize
  109. *OpenUI *PageRegion: PickOne
  110. *OrderDependency: 30 AnySetup *PageRegion
  111. *DefaultPageRegion: Letter
  112. *PageRegion Letter: "
  113.     2 dict dup /PageSize [612 792] put dup /ImagingBBox null put setpagedevice"
  114. *End
  115. *PageRegion Legal: "
  116.     2 dict dup /PageSize [612 1008] put dup /ImagingBBox null put setpagedevice"
  117. *End
  118. *PageRegion A4: "
  119.     2 dict dup /PageSize [595 842] put dup /ImagingBBox null put setpagedevice"
  120. *End
  121. *PageRegion Executive: "
  122.     2 dict dup /PageSize [522 757] put dup /ImagingBBox null put setpagedevice"
  123. *End
  124. *CloseUI: *PageRegion
  125. *DefaultImageableArea: Letter
  126. *ImageableArea Letter: "15 15 598 777"
  127. *ImageableArea Legal: "15 15 598 993"
  128. *ImageableArea A4: "15 15 580 827"
  129. *ImageableArea Executive: "15 15 507 741"
  130. *?ImageableArea: "
  131.  save /cvp { cvi (            ) cvs print ( ) print } bind def
  132.   newpath clippath pathbbox
  133.   4 -2 roll exch 2 {ceiling cvp} repeat
  134.   exch 2 {floor cvp} repeat flush
  135.  restore
  136. "
  137. *End
  138. *DefaultPaperDimension: Letter
  139. *PaperDimension Letter: "612 792"
  140. *PaperDimension Legal: "612 1008"
  141. *PaperDimension A4: "595 842"
  142. *PaperDimension Executive: "522 757"
  143. *OpenUI *ManualFeed: Boolean
  144. *OrderDependency: 20 AnySetup *ManualFeed
  145. *DefaultManualFeed: False
  146. *?ManualFeed: "
  147.   save
  148.     currentpagedevice /ManualFeed get
  149.     {(True)}{(False)}ifelse = flush
  150.   restore"
  151. *End
  152. *ManualFeed True: "1 dict dup /ManualFeed true put setpagedevice"
  153. *ManualFeed False: "1 dict dup /ManualFeed false put setpagedevice"
  154. *CloseUI: *ManualFeed
  155. *OpenUI *InputSlot: PickOne
  156. *OrderDependency: 20 AnySetup *InputSlot
  157. *DefaultInputSlot: Upper
  158. *InputSlot Upper: "
  159.    currentpagedevice /InputAttributes get
  160.    1 get dup null eq {pop}
  161.       { dup /InputAttributes
  162.          1 dict dup /Priority [1] put
  163.       put setpagedevice } ifelse"
  164. *End
  165. *InputSlot Lower: "
  166.    currentpagedevice /InputAttributes get
  167.    2 get dup null eq {pop}
  168.       { dup /InputAttributes
  169.          1 dict dup /Priority [2] put
  170.       put setpagedevice } ifelse"
  171. *End
  172. *?InputSlot: "
  173. save
  174.    [(Unknown) (Upper) (Lower)]
  175.    currentpagedevice /InputAttributes get
  176.    /Priority get aload pop dup 2 gt {pop 3} if
  177.    get = flush restore"
  178. *End
  179. *CloseUI: *InputSlot
  180. *DefaultOutputBin: Upper
  181. *DefaultDuplex: None
  182. *OpenUI *Collate: Boolean
  183. *OrderDependency: 50 AnySetup *Collate
  184. *DefaultCollate: False
  185. *Collate True: "1 dict dup /Collate true put setpagedevice"
  186. *Collate False: "1 dict dup /Collate false put setpagedevice"
  187. *?Collate: "
  188. save
  189.   currentpagedevice /Collate get
  190.   {(True)}{(False)}ifelse = flush
  191. restore
  192. "
  193. *End
  194. *CloseUI: *Collate
  195. *OpenUI *TraySwitch: Boolean
  196. *OrderDependency: 50 AnySetup *TraySwitch
  197. *DefaultTraySwitch: False
  198. *TraySwitch True: "1 dict dup /TraySwitch true put setpagedevice"
  199. *TraySwitch False: "1 dict dup /TraySwitch false put setpagedevice"
  200. *?TraySwitch: "
  201. save
  202.   currentpagedevice /TraySwitch get
  203.   {(True)}{(False)}ifelse = flush
  204. restore
  205. "
  206. *End
  207. *CloseUI: *TraySwitch
  208. *DefaultFont: Courier
  209. *Font AvantGarde-Book: Standard "(001.006)"
  210. *Font AvantGarde-BookOblique: Standard "(001.006)"
  211. *Font AvantGarde-Demi: Standard "(001.007)"
  212. *Font AvantGarde-DemiOblique: Standard "(001.007)"
  213. *Font Bookman-Demi: Standard "(001.003)"
  214. *Font Bookman-DemiItalic: Standard "(001.003)"
  215. *Font Bookman-Light: Standard "(001.003)"
  216. *Font Bookman-LightItalic: Standard "(001.003)"
  217. *Font Courier: Standard "(002.004)"
  218. *Font Courier-Bold: Standard "(002.004)"
  219. *Font Courier-BoldOblique: Standard "(002.004)"
  220. *Font Courier-Oblique: Standard "(002.004)"
  221. *Font Helvetica: Standard "(001.006)"
  222. *Font Helvetica-Bold: Standard "(001.007)"
  223. *Font Helvetica-BoldOblique: Standard "(001.007)"
  224. *Font Helvetica-Condensed: Standard "(001.001)"
  225. *Font Helvetica-Condensed-Bold: Standard "(001.002)"
  226. *Font Helvetica-Condensed-BoldObl: Standard "(001.002)"
  227. *Font Helvetica-Condensed-Oblique: Standard "(001.001)"
  228. *Font Helvetica-Narrow: Standard "(001.006)"
  229. *Font Helvetica-Narrow-Bold: Standard "(001.007)"
  230. *Font Helvetica-Narrow-BoldOblique: Standard "(001.007)"
  231. *Font Helvetica-Narrow-Oblique: Standard "(001.006)"
  232. *Font Helvetica-Oblique: Standard "(001.006)"
  233. *Font NewCenturySchlbk-Bold: Standard "(001.009)"
  234. *Font NewCenturySchlbk-BoldItalic: Standard "(001.007)"
  235. *Font NewCenturySchlbk-Italic: Standard "(001.006)"
  236. *Font NewCenturySchlbk-Roman: Standard "(001.007)"
  237. *Font Palatino-Bold: Standard "(001.005)"
  238. *Font Palatino-BoldItalic: Standard "(001.005)"
  239. *Font Palatino-Italic: Standard "(001.005)"
  240. *Font Palatino-Roman: Standard "(001.005)"
  241. *Font Symbol: Special "(001.007)"
  242. *Font Times-Bold: Standard "(001.007)"
  243. *Font Times-BoldItalic: Standard "(001.009)"
  244. *Font Times-Italic: Standard "(001.007)"
  245. *Font Times-Roman: Standard "(001.007)"
  246. *Font ZapfChancery-MediumItalic: Standard "(001.007)"
  247. *Font ZapfDingbats: Special "(001.004)"
  248. *Font Aachen-Bold: Standard "(001.001)"
  249. *Font BrushScript: Standard "(001.001)"
  250. *Font Cooper-Black: Standard "(001.001)"
  251. *Font CooperBlack-Italic: Standard "(001.001)"
  252. *Font FreestyleScript: Standard "(001.001)"
  253. *Font Garamond-Bold: Standard "(001.001)"
  254. *Font Garamond-BoldItalic: Standard "(001.001)"
  255. *Font Garamond-Light: Standard "(001.001)"
  256. *Font Garamond-LightItalic: Standard "(001.001)"
  257. *Font Helvetica-Black: Standard "(001.001)"
  258. *Font Helvetica-BlackOblique: Standard "(001.001)"
  259. *Font Helvetica-Light: Standard "(001.001)"
  260. *Font Helvetica-LightOblique: Standard "(001.001)"
  261. *Font Hobo: Standard "(001.001)"
  262. *Font LetterGothic: Standard "(001.001)"
  263. *Font LetterGothic-Bold: Standard "(001.001)"
  264. *Font LetterGothic-BoldSlanted: Standard "(001.001)"
  265. *Font LetterGothic-Slanted: Standard "(001.001)"
  266. *Font Optima: Standard "(001.001)"
  267. *Font Optima-Bold: Standard "(001.001)"
  268. *Font Optima-BoldOblique: Standard "(001.001)"
  269. *Font Optima-Oblique: Standard "(001.001)"
  270. *Font ParkAvenue: Standard "(001.001)"
  271. *Font Revue: Standard "(001.001)"
  272. *Font Stencil: Standard "(001.001)"
  273. *Font UniversityRoman: Standard "(001.001)"
  274.